Jun Yang is a medical physicist, specializing in stereotactic radiosurgery (SRS), stereotactic body radiation therapy (SBRT), and robotic radiosurgery.
His research has included the development of the “red shell” concept for evaluating normal-tissue exposure in SBRT[1] and the investigation of stereotactic central/core ablative radiation therapy (SCART) for bulky tumors[2]. He was a co-author of the 2017 American Association of Physicists in Medicine (AAPM)–Radiosurgery Society Medical Physics Practice Guideline for SRS and SBRT,[3] and later co-authored AAPM Task Group Report 135.B on quality assurance for robotic radiosurgery.[4]
Education and career
Yang received a PhD in biomedical engineering from the University of Miami in 2006.[5] He subsequently worked in medical physics in the United States and participated in the establishment of Philadelphia CyberKnife.[5] He later served as chief physicist at Philadelphia CyberKnife and as chief physicist at Alliance Oncology from 2013 to 2019, while serving as a clinical associate professor at Drexel University.[6][7][8]
Yang served on the board of The Radiosurgery Society and chaired its Physics Committee from 2013 to 2021.[5]
Yang later returned to China and joined Foshan Fosun Chancheng Hospital, where he helped establish the hospital's Precision Oncology Diagnosis and Treatment Center and served as its director.[9][10]
Research
Yang's research has focused on stereotactic radiotherapy and medical physics. In 2010, he was the lead author of a study introducing the term "red shell" to describe a region of normal tissue surrounding an SBRT target that may receive radiation doses above tissue tolerance.[1] The concept was subsequently discussed in independent scholarly literature on radiobiological optimization in SBRT, which identified Yang and colleagues as having introduced the linear-quadratic-model-based “red shell” concept.[11]
He was one of the seven authors of the 2017 AAPM–RSS Medical Physics Practice Guideline 9.a for SRS and SBRT, which set out medical-physics practice guidance for stereotactic radiosurgery and stereotactic body radiation therapy.[3] [12] In 2025, he was also a co-author of AAPM Task Group Report 135.B, which provided updated quality-assurance guidance for robotic radiosurgery.[4]
In 2024, Yang was the lead author of a phase I study of SCART, a spatially heterogeneous radiotherapy approach investigated for bulky recurrent or metastatic tumors.[2] Subsequent peer-reviewed studies by other research groups have examined SCART. [13][14]
